Transaction 03d63e062398980285dd752cffe3f6aade106dfec35b8181bb02ad008fcb065a

1 Input
2 Outputs
  • 03d63e062398980285dd752cffe3f6aade106dfec35b8181bb02ad008fcb065a:0
  • value  6219
    address  1McRhiTKLM8L8sX52R88moa6GzTNCRNh8f
  • 03d63e062398980285dd752cffe3f6aade106dfec35b8181bb02ad008fcb065a:1
  • value  16168920
    address  16CJBejRkLmoVuoSdDfNsPF3LXXNpXk8wg